If upon the expiration of the contract the cropper continues to cultivate the farm for thirty (30) days with the acquiescence of the landholder, it shall be understood that the contract has been renewed for a term equal to that of the original contract or for the term established in § 203 of this title, unless previous demand has been made to the contrary. History —May 4, 1931, No. 76, p. 466, § 12, eff. 90 days after May 4, 1931.
